During break, when students were flooding the hall to grab a quick snack, Soojung disappeared for a moment, then came back to class with a can of soda in her hands. She grabbed Seulgi's arm and pulled her away from her seat, leading her to the classroom where most of the popular kids were located. The two girls stood a few feet away from the classroom, waiting to see if the door would open.

"What are we doing?" Seulgi whispered.

"Hold up," Soojung said. She pushed the soda in Seulgi's hand. "Open it."

"What?"

"Open the can!" Soojung urged. 

Without a moment of hesitation, Seulgi did as she was told. She lifted the tab and opened the can. The drink fizzed, but didn't explode. She looked back at Soojung, who seemed to be keeping a keen eye at the door.

"What now?" Seulgi asked.

"Naeun comes out to use the restroom alone during this time. When she comes out, you're going to bump into her, spill the drink, say that it's your fault, and take her to he bathroom where you'll talk with her," Soojung explained.

"Oh, okay. That makes a lot of—Wait, wait, wait." Seulgi gulped nervously and had her hands around the can of open soda she had in her hand. "Y-You want me to purposely bump into Naeun?"

"Well, yeah. I figured that for you, that would be the easiest way to get close to her," Soojung said. "She only stands in crowded place, so you're going to need to be extra careful that the drink spills on her and only her."

"What about her clothes? How do I know that she has something else to wear?" Seulgi cried out.

"She has her gym uniform. If not that, then she definitely has extra clothes. She's Naeun. Naeun is always prepared for nearly everything," Soojung said.

"Wait, what am I supposed to say?"

"Talk about Jongin," Soojung said.

"Oh, that's easy. Jongin is my favorite subject—"

"And now!" Soojung whispered. The door opened and Naeun was at the entrance. Soojung pushed Seulgi towards the door and disappeared with the crowd.

Seulgi, stumbling on her feet, managed to arrive in front of Naeun. However, the drink flew out of her hand and the can hit the floor. The drink splashed all over the floor, getting on three people's shoes, including Seulgi's.

Seulgi bit her bottom lip and slowly looked up, noticing that Naeun's shoes were slightly wet while Sehun, who happened to be standing behind her, had his shoes drenched. She mentally cursed herself and looked down at her own shoes, noticing that her shoes were a bit more wet than Naeun's, but not drenched like Sehun's.

I'm so sure that none of them have extra shoes, Seulgi thought, feeling guilty. She took a step to check if the two were okay, but she accidentally slipped and lost her balance. She let out a scream before falling on her bottom, getting her skirt drenched.

She froze at her spot, mortified. A few people stared at her and looked away, while most managed a chuckle before walking away. Seulgi's cheeks grew incredibly red as she noticed what kind of situation she was in. Moreover, out of all the people who saw her fall, Sehun was standing right in front of her. She looked behind her shoulder, hoping that Soojung would make her appearance and help her out.

Sehun let out a sigh. "What are you doing?"

Seulgi remained silent, flustered. Naeun raised out her hand in concern.

"Oh my god, are you okay?" Naeun asked.

Do I look okay? Seulgi wanted to say. She tried to grab for Naeun's hand, but someone else took her hand and helped her up. The three looked over at Jongin, who seemed a bit surprised to see the mess.

"What happened here?" Jongin asked.

"I-I slipped," Seulgi stuttered.

"You should go to the nurse's office. Do you have extra clothes or shoes?" Jongin asked. He turned to Sehun. "I got some extra shoes for you in my locker."

"I have an extra skirt. You seem like you'll fit my size," Naeun said to Seulgi. "Do you have any extra shoes?" Seulgi shook her head. "I don't have any extra, either. We'll have to go to the nurse's office."

"Yeah, let me just help you clean up in the bathroom," Seulgi said quickly.

"But I don't have to go to the bathroom right now," Naeun said. "I just need to head to the office."

"R-Right, yeah," Seulgi said, blinking her eyes. "Yeah, I'm the one who needs to go to the bathroom since my clothes are wet…"

"Yes. Well, I'll see you at the nurse's office or maybe later—"

"Oh my god, Seulgi!" a voice cried out. Everyone looked up and saw Soojung running towards Seulgi. She had a look of worry on her face while Seulgi looked relieved.

Soojung, my savior! What would I do without you? Seulgi thought.

"Is that my drink? Geez, I knew that I shouldn't have made you hold it. I'm so sorry that I left to use the bathroom," Soojung said. She looked at the mess. "We need to get this cleaned up." She turned to Naeun. "Naeun, can you do me a favor and go to the bathroom with Seulgi to clean herself up? I'll stay here and alert the janitor to come and clean the mess."

"I-I'll stay here, too!" Jongin said quickly.

"Dude, I need your shoes," Sehun said.

"You know my locker combination," Jongin muttered.

"I know that you changed it because you complained that I kept going through your locker too much," Sehun pointed out.

Jongin frowned. "Fine. Let's go."

The boys left while Soojung stood next to the mess. She waved to Seulgi, urging to her go on. Seulgi nodded and started to walk away with Naeun, who seemed confused and a bit lost with the situation.

As Soojung stood, she noticed Hyeri coming out of the door. The two girls eyed at each other, but didn't say anything. When Suzy poked her head out the door, her eyes grew wide.

"What happened around here?" Suzy cried out.

"Just a little accident," Soojung said. "Please be careful walking around here."

"I'll get the janitor," Hyeri said, looking at the spilled mess.

"Thanks," Soojung replied.

Hyeri didn't say anything. She left to find the janitor with Suzy, leaving Soojung to guard the mess that she helped create.

/ / / / /

"Thank you so much for helping me clean up," Seulgi said to Naeun, who used a wet towel to dab the back of Seulgi's skirt.

"No problem! I'm always happy to help," Naeun said cheerfully. "What happened, anyway?"

"Oh, um, Soojung asked me to hold her drink because she needed to use the restroom really badly. I was walking around a little and somehow ended up dropping the drink. Coincidentally, you were there and got wet," Seulgi said, making up the entire story at the spot.

"I see," Naeun said, not even questioning it. "You ought to be careful, though. You saw how you slipped. It looked painful."

"It kind of was," Seulgi mumbled, feeling a bit sore. She looked at Naeun. "You're so nice, Naeun. Thanks again for helping me."

She beamed. "Like I said, I'm happy to help!"

Seulgi paused before asking her a random question. "Do you have a boyfriend, Naeun?"

Naeun seemed a little taken aback. "Me? A boyfriend? No."

"Why not? You're really nice," Seulgi said, thinking about what had happened in the past few days. "You're smart, considerate, and kind."

Naeun giggled. "I'm flattered, but guys don't seem like they want to approach me. I don't know, I think they think too highly of me."

"Then do you have a guy you like?" Seulgi asked out of the blue.

Naeun's cheeks turned pink. "A-A guy I like? W-Well, I guess you can say that there's someone that I'm interested in…"

"Is it Jongin?" Seulgi inquired, remembering how Soojung told her to talk about Jongin.

Naeun stopped moving. She pressed her lips together firmly before continuing to dab Seulgi's skirt.

"No," she lied. "I can't love the same guy as my best friend. That's crazy, right?"

"Oh, yeah. I totally get it," Seulgi said, nodding her head. Why did Soojung tell me to talk about Jongin? It doesn't look like this conversation is going anywhere.

"But you seem quite close to Jongin," Naeun said out of the blue. She finally gazed up at Seulgi. "Are you two friends?"

"Friends?" Seulgi pressed her lips and frowned. Wait, am I considered to be close to Jongin? Is that how people see us? Oh my god. I'm making progress! I can't believe it!

"Are you two not?" Naeun asked with a bit of hope in her tone.

"W-Well, it's not like we're too close or anything, b-but yeah," Seulgi stuttered, blushing a little.

Naeun took notice and looked back down at her skirt. "A lot of people have a crush on him, but it doesn't seem like they actually try to confess."

"There's Hyeri. She's an obstacle," Seulgi said.

"Yeah, I know that a lot of people feel intimidated when Hyeri's around, but she doesn't determine who Jongin dates, right? Jongin is the one decides," Naeun pointed out. She smiled at Seulgi. "You might have a chance, you know?"

"Maybe, but—" Seulgi stopped. She slowly glanced to her side at the mirror, noticing that Naeun had a strange smile on her face. It was like she was just saying that out of politeness, but didn't really believe that she had the chance. Suddenly, Seulgi started to feel intimidated. Wait, did I even say that I like Jongin? I only said that I think I'm close to him. That doesn't mean that I like him, right? Oh, but the way I've been talking makes it seem like I do…Crap. Did I just follow her flow of the conversation?

"But what?" Naeun asked, snapping her out of her thoughts.

"O-Oh. Um, well, I was just going to say that I don't think I'm ready to, uh…" Seulgi wasn't sure how to rephrase her words to make it seem like she didn't like Jongin. She felt cornered, exposed, and lost. She had lowered her guard down too much and ended up losing control of the entire conversation. No matter which direction she took with the conversation, she knew that she would leak out personal information or motives.

I need help, Seulgi thought. She looked at Naeun's eyes through the mirror, where she looked back, awaiting for her response.

Before anything else could happen, the door swung open. Seunghwan came in, slightly breathless. She had a look of concern on her face as she approached Seulgi. Gently pushing Naeun away, she checked Seulgi's skirt and looked at her worriedly.

"Seulgi, what happened? I came here as fast as I could!" Seunghwan exclaimed.

"She had a small accident," Naeun said.

"Really? This doesn't look so small," Seunghwan said. She looked back at Seulgi. "What are you going to do with your skirt? Do you have an extra?"

"I have one in my locker," Naeun told her. "I'll go grab it right now."

"Sure, thanks Naeun!" Seunghwan said. Naeun nodded and walked out of the empty bathroom, leaving the two girls. Once she was gone, Seunghwan let out a small grunt and rolled her eyes. "ing . Thinks that she's all great and that."

Seulgi was slightly taken aback by Seunghwan's new personality. "What do you mean?"

"Trust me, you don't want to get too close to Naeun. She acts like an innocent rich princess, but she's not. She's just a black hole that absorbs information. Hyeri and Suzy are completely oblivious to this. Jinri and I were the only ones aware of the group, and every time Naeun screwed up, we'd get the consequences," Seunghwan explained. "Like, one time, Hyeri found out that Jongin knew that she was going to throw him a surprise birthday party and since he knew about it, he asked her not to do it. Hyeri was so mad, but no matter how many times I said that I didn't tell him, she thought it was me."

"So who told Jongin about the surprise?" Seulgi asked.

"Naeun did, duh. Hyeri only told Suzy about it, but she told her during class when Jongin wasn't in the classroom. Naeun and I sit around Hyeri, so we both heard it."

"Where was Jinri? Couldn't she have said something? She's a gossip queen."

"Jinri was absent. There was no way she would've said anything. Anyway, one day Hyeri confronted me and said that I was the one who told him. Like, why would I even want to tell him that Hyeri was throwing him a surprise party? There's no incentive for me to do that, you know?" Seunghwan continued. "The only person I could think was Naeun, but it didn't make sense because at that time, I just thought that Naeun was the sweetest person in the world." She made another face. "Of course, later I learned that being sweet and nice doesn't mean being loyal."

"So Naeun told Jongin?" Seulgi asked. "How did you find out?"

"A few days later, I saw Jongin walk back home with Naeun. Suzy and Hyeri had other school-related activities, so I was going to find Naeun, but I happened to see them walk together. Naturally, I followed, and while I was eavesdropping on their conversation, I heard Jongin thank Naeun for telling him about the party. I just don't know why she told him," Seunghwan grumbled.

"Doesn't it kind of sound like she…likes him?" Seulgi said in a small voice.

"Naeun? Like Jongin? Why would she like the same guy that Hyeri likes? That's, like, a no-no," Seunghwan said.

"But why's that a no-no?"

"If you know anything about Hyeri, you know that she's been chasing after him for years. They met when they were kids, you know?" Seunghwan sighed. "Well, I'm just glad that I don't need to deal with her. Being in the same group as her was exhausting. She's nice and kind, but she'll extract everything she wants to know about you in seconds. Then she'll use that to make herself look like a victim or to make herself look good."

Seulgi nodded. The more she thought about it, the more she felt that Naeun was actually one of the most dangerous people she had ever encountered. She was overly kind and sweet, and that facade helped hide her true intentions. Seulgi paled and shuddered.

The door opened, and Youngji came in. She was out of breath, tired, and a little bit sweaty. In her hands, she had an extra skirt and a pair of slippers. She quickly walked over to the two girls and widened her eyes.

"Seulgi, are you okay? I heard that you slipped and fell, so I came here as fast as I could!" Youngji exclaimed. "I brought an extra skirt and an extra shoe. If you want, you can change—"

Naeun walked into the bathroom with the extra skirt in her hand. She seemed a bit surprised to see Youngji standing with them. She looked at the extra skirt in Youngji's hand, then smiled awkwardly at Seulgi.

"Oh, you had a friend with an extra skirt?" Naeun said. "Should I put mine away?"

"I-It's fine, I'll wear yours," Seulgi said, taking Naeun's skirt. She gave a sharp look at Youngji, who looked confused. "You're a bit late."

Youngji blinked her eyes. "Yeah, well, I was on my here, but I was told that you were at another bathroom…"

Youngji's eyes gazed over at Seunghwan, who faked a smile.

"Oh, sorry! I really thought she was at the bathroom on the first floor. Which, now that I think about it, doesn't make any sense," Seunghwan said, laughing.

Youngji slightly scowled. "Yeah, that's what I kept saying, but you kept pushing me to check the bathroom two floors down from here—"

"If you really thought that she was here, then you should've just said that you'll check here and had me check the first floor," Seunghwan said in a matter-of-fact tone.

Youngji opened to say something, but couldn't. She knew she couldn't. She closed mouth and sealed her lips while slowly nodding.

"Yeah," she said in a bitter voice. "You're right about that."

"Well, I'm glad that you were there for me, Seunghwan," Seulgi said, giving her a hug. She pulled away and walked over to Naeun, taking her skirt. "I'll make sure to bring it tomorrow."

Naeun smiled. "Sure. Well, I'll go now. I need to see if the nurse has some extra slippers."

"Oh, take these!" Seulgi exclaimed. She lunged towards Youngji, swiped away the extra slippers, and handed it to Naeun. "I'm okay with wet shoes."

Naeun, still smiling, looked at Youngji, who seemed a bit hurt. 

"Are these yours?" Naeun asked. Youngji nodded. "Do you mind if I use it, then? I'll return it to you tomorrow, too."

"Yeah, sure," Youngji said quietly. 

"Thank you. Now, if you'll excuse me…" Naeun waved at the girls and walked away.

Seunghwan checked her phone for the time. "It's almost time to go. I'll head out first, okay? Let's have lunch later with Taehyun."

"Of course! See you then!" Seulgi exclaimed. She bid Seunghwan a "goodbye" and watched her leave the bathroom.

Just when Seulgi was about to enter the toilet stall to change, she noticed Youngji's worried expression. She didn't bother asking her what was wrong. She walked into the stall and locked it behind her before she started to change.

After a few seconds of silence, Seulgi could see Youngji's feet standing in front of her stall.

"Um, Seulgi?" Youngji said in a small voice.

"What?" Seulgi asked.

"I-I know you're making new friends, and I think that's great. You're doing a great job, but…" Youngji seemed a bit hesitant. "Well, I don't think you're making the right friends."

Seulgi stopped raising her leg. She looked at the door as if she was looking through it to see Youngji.

"What?" Seulgi repeated.

"I-I-I know this sounds crazy, and I might be jealous that my best friend is being taken away from me, but I just don't think that Seunghwan is a good friend."

"But she's popular and likable."

"I know that, but is that the only reason why you're friends with her? I didn't want to bring this up, but when I heard that you slipped and fell, I was going to the bathroom closest to where I heard that you fell. While I was going, Seunghwan met up with me and told me to check the bathrooms two floors down. She was really…scary. I-I'm not trying to make her out as a bully. She's nowhere close to that, but she's…very intimidating. I got the sense that if she didn't get her way, then she would've made some way possible to get what she wanted," Youngji said with difficulty. 

The door finally opened. Youngji turned. Her expression fell when she saw Seulgi's cold glare.

"I don't appreciate you talking like that about my friends," was the only thing Seulgi said before she left the bathroom.

Youngji stood still, frozen. Then, she let out a shaky sigh and nodded her head.

"Right," Youngji whispered. "Sorry…"
